$250K Worth of 'Handy' Strokers Stolen From Freight Train

LOS ANGELES—About $250,000 worth of manufacturer Ohdoki's "The Handy" male sex toys went missing on a freight train en route to Dallas, Texas, that departed Los Angeles back in February, according to local reports. Two pallets of the toys from the Oslo, Norway-based company were taken in the apparent heist.

According to The CW affiliate KTLA, the container seals were broken on several shipments when the train arrived on site in Dallas. A spokesperson for Ohdoki said that the shipments were stolen "somewhere between the product's departure from [Los Angeles] and arrival in Dallas."

The Handy is a popular automatic interactive stroker that is integrated with video and virtual reality. The representative who spoke with KTLA confirmed that 289 “The Handy Massage 2 PRO” units and 330 “The Handy Massage 2 REG” units were lost in the incident.
 
As AVN previously reported, The Handy 2 and The Handy 2 Pro were released last year, featuring a built-in battery and a universal USB-C port.
